Atanu Saha-HS

Atanu Saha, a Partner with StoneTurn, has over 25 years of experience in the application of economics and finance to complex business issues. He has served as an expert witness in numerous prior matters and provided testimony in disputes related to patent infringement, antitrust, market manipulation, securities, valuation of investment portfolios and contract dispute damages.

An expert witness in matters involving a wide range of issues, Dr. Saha’s research has been cited by the U.S. Court of Appeals for the 11th Circuit. He applies considerable expertise in the energy, financial services, technology, and healthcare sectors, as well as a specialization in data analytics, to assist clients across a range of industries with data-driven insights.

Earlier in his career, he co-founded Data Science Partners, as well as held senior positions at other consulting firms, including Analysis Group, Alix Partners and Compass Lexecon. In addition, Dr. Saha was a tenure-track professor at Texas A&M University where he taught Ph.D.-level courses in econometrics and applied economics.

Dr. Saha is the author of numerous refereed journal articles, monographs and book chapters and his research has been cited in various publications, including The Wall Street Journal, The Economist, and The New York Times. He is the recipient of the prestigious Graham and Dodd Award for financial research.
